LT2A01 thru LT2A07
PLASTIC SILICON RECTIFIERS
FEATURES
Low cost
Diffused junction
Low forward voltage drop
Low reverse leakage current
High current capability
The plastic material carries UL recognition 94V-0
MECHANICAL DATA
Case : JEDEC DO-15 molded plastic
Polarity : Color band denotes cathode
Weight : 0.015 ounces, 0.4 grams
Mounting position : Any
